Each week on Profit Points, I break down one financial concept using real examples, practical insights, and simple language so you can make smarter decisions, increase profitability, and build a business that truly supports your life.In this episode, we're talking about one of the biggest profit leaks in small business: pricing mistakes. Many business owners set their prices based on fear, assumptions, or what "feels right" rather than what their numbers are actually telling them. I'll walk you through three common pricing mistakes that quietly drain profits, explain why they're happening, and show you how to make pricing decisions with more confidence so you can improve profitability without sacrificing your best clients.In This Episode, You'll learn:Why failing to review your pricing regularly can hurt your profitabilityHow inflation and rising business costs impact your pricing strategyWhat profit margins are and why they matter when setting pricesWhy pricing based on feelings instead of numbers can keep you stuckThe risks of discounting simply to win new clientsAlternative ways to increase value without lowering your pricesHow small price increases can significantly improve your bottom lineWhy higher prices don't automatically mean losing customersThis episode is for small business owners, entrepreneurs, service providers, freelancers, consultants, and anyone who wants to feel more confident about pricing their products or services profitably.
